If you’re having trouble accessing customer service from a company that sells products, you can try contacting the sales department. Humans in one department can often direct you to humans in another department, too. Sometimes it may take a few tries before it actually responds to your request. With automated voice systems, you can often say “Speak to an Agent”, “Agent”, “Representative”, or something similar to get a human being, even if the system just asks you to describe your problem. If you do need to talk to someone on the phone, there are a few ways to skip the tree and get a human being. Often, you can simply keep pressing “0” on the number pad-for “operator”-until the system directs you to a human.

But Amazon, for example, offers online chat, email, and telephone interaction if you visit its support site. This won’t always work-sometimes you really do need a back-and-forth interaction with human beings. Some companies even offer email support, allowing you to contact a human with a problem. Check the company’s website to see if it offers customer support via online chat, and try that option if it exists. Sometimes, you might even get a human immediately, while telephone lines may often have long waits. You may still have to answer a few questions, but it’ll be much faster, and the wait times are usually much shorter. A lot of companies also offer an online chat interface, allowing you to talk to a a human being from your keyboard.
